Peanut Butter Cup Brownies

ingredients
-
Brownies
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1⁄4 teaspoon salt
- 1⁄4 teaspoon baking powder
- 10 ounces semisweet chocolate, chopped
- 1 cup butter
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 5 large eggs
- 1 1⁄2 teaspoons vanilla extract
- 1 (8 ounce) package miniature peanut butter cups, quartered, divided
-
Frosting
- 2 cups confectioners' sugar
- 1⁄2 cup creamy peanut butter
- 4 -6 tablespoons milk
directions
- Brownies: Preheat oven to 350°F.
- Line bottom and 2 sides of 8-inch square baking pan with foil.
- In a bowl, combine flour, salt, and baking powder; set aside.
- In a pot, melt chocolate and butter over medium heat.
- Remove from heat and stir in sugar, eggs, and vanilla until combined.
- Stir in flour mixture until combined.
- Spread 1 cup of batter in pan.
- Set aside about 32 peanut butter cup quarters and sprinkle remaining onto batter in pan and top with remaining batter.
- Bake for about 40 minutes or until edges are set and center is slightly soft.
- Cool completely on rack before frosting.
- Frosting: At low speed, beat sugar with the peanut butter until almost combined, about 30 seconds.
- Beat in milk, 1 tablespoon at a time, until frosting is smooth and spreadable.
- Spread over top of cooled brownies and sprinkle with remaining reserved peanut butter cups.
